Compare 18/10 and 48/4

1st number: 1 8/10, 2nd number: 12 0/4

18/10 is smaller than 48/4

Steps for comparing fractions

  1.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
    LCM of 10 and 4 is 20

    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 20
  2. For the 1st fraction, since 10 × 2 = 20,
    18/10 = 18 × 2/10 × 2 = 36/20
  3.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 4 × 5 = 20,
    48/4 = 48 × 5/4 × 5 = 240/20
  4. Since the denominators are now the same, the fraction with the bigger numerator is the greater fraction
  5. 36/20 < 240/20 or 18/10 < 48/4
